* s/o James Absalem Coursey & Rebecca Adeline Sharp
* Served in US Navy during WWI, 1917-1918.
* Married Catherine Macdonald December 1, 1929,in Reno, NV.
* Children: Eula Jean, Ruth and Karen Ann.
* Rex was a lighthouse keeper on the west coast from 1929 until 1945, serving on several lighthouses. He moved to Antioch, California, worked for and retired from US Steel in 1963, moved to Carson City, NV in 1964 and later to Yerington, Nevada. He was living in Carson City, NV when he passed away on November 1, 1981.
